At its July 15 Committee of the Whole meeting, the Village of Roscoe committee recommended sending a resolution and a hold-harmless agreement to the board that would provide funds—about $4,000—to cover a mural in the Masonic Lodge building, and discussed billing and liability arrangements for the contractor.

The Village of Roscoe Committee of the Whole on July 15 recommended that the village board consider a hold-harmless agreement and funding for a mural inside the Masonic Lodge of Roscoe, and asked staff to prepare a draft resolution and a short agreement for the lodge to sign.
